Microservices have become the new hotness. What are they and why would you use them? We'll use a fictitious hotel management system as an example for designing and implementing a microservices based API.
• What makes a good "service" ("micro" or otherwise)?
• Requirements: Events, commands, workflows, read models. Introduction to eventstorming.
• Strategic design: Domains, bounded contexts, fit with business objectives and priorities.
• Code: A C# sample implementation. (CQRS + event sourcing)
• Rollout planning/project management/maintenance: The payoff. This is where a "microservices" based solution really shines. We'll look at some opportunities and gotchas.
